How much do cineplex guest service j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 10, 2026, the average hourly pay for cineplex guest service in the United States is $14.47,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$12.98 and $15.87 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Cineplex Guest Service vs Cineplex Concession Attendant?

AspectCineplex Guest ServiceCineplex Concession Attendant
Primary RoleAssisting guests, ticketing, providing informationPreparing and selling food and beverages at concession stands
Work EnvironmentLobby, ticket counters, guest areasConcession stands, food prep areas
CredentialsCustomer service skills, basic cash handlingFood safety knowledge, cash handling skills
Employer/Industry UsageCommonly employed in theaters, customer-focusedCommonly employed in theaters, food service

While both roles are customer-facing positions at Cineplex, the Guest Service role focuses on assisting guests with tickets and information, whereas the Concession Attendant specializes in food and beverage service. Both roles require strong customer service skills, but differ in daily tasks and work environment.

What is the hiring process like at Cineplex Guest Service?

The hiring process for a Cineplex Guest Service position typically involves submitting an online application, followed by an interview, which may be in person or virtual. Candidates may also undergo background checks and training before starting the role, which often requires good communication skills and a friendly attitude.

What qualifications do I need to work at a Cineplex Guest Service?

To work as a Cineplex Guest Service associate, candidates typically need a high school diploma or equivalent and strong customer service skills. Previous experience in retail or hospitality can be beneficial, and the role often requires the ability to handle cash transactions and operate basic computer systems. Flexibility to work evenings, weekends, and holidays is also common.

JOB SUMMARY
Shall assist Cineplex guests with sales, directions, ticket collection, seating, and theater maintenance. Provides food and beverage service to Cineplex guests, including handling food products safely, processing payment, and maintaining the cleanliness of the Cineplex.
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S:
  1. Shall promote customer satisfaction and return visits through prompt, friendly, and efficient service.
  2. Will graciously accept admission tickets from guests entering the Cineplex lobby and provide directions to the proper theatre.
  3. Greets each guest with a smile and a quick offering of service. Upsells specials.
  4. Enters food orders into POS accepts payment for orders and accurately issues change due.
  5. Handles all foodstuff in a healthful manner consistent with food handling practices.
  6. Responsible for the accuracy of cash, including confirming a pre/post shift balance of cash with ticket or food sales.
  7. Assists with inventory needs as directed, including supply needs, order checklist, stocking of product received, rotating products under FIFO, etc.
  8. Provides deep cleaning of facility and equipment each shift or as directed.
  9. Will perform other Cineplex duties as business dictates, including working in box office sales, or ushering.
  10. Responsible for overall cleanliness of the facility, helping replenish supplies and materials, picking up and discarding used products and garbage, wiping down public areas, carpet sweeping the floors, etc.
  11. Assists guests as appropriate, opening doors, providing direction, answering inquiries, etc.
  12. Handles door closing/opening before and after each movie.
  13. Provides cleaning of theatre in between movies, quickly removing trash and carpet sweeping.
  14. Maintains lobby area in a clean, organized manner, including emptying trash containers, wiping signage windows and displays, carpet sweeping, and dusting.
  15. Assists with maintaining restrooms, replenishing supplies as needed, wiping counters, emptying trash, sweeping floors, etc.
  16. Promotes a safe, clean environment, preventing slip and fall hazards. Promptly reports hazards to supervisor.
  17. Other related duties as assigned.

M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S:
  1. Six (6) months of customer service experience.
  2. Cash handling experience.
  3. Computer and POS experience helpful.
  4. Good interpersonal skills to interact with people.
  5. Must present a friendly demeanor and a neat and clean appearance.
  6. High school diploma/GED or ten years' experience OR current student 16-18 years of age.
  7. Requires a Food Handler's Card within 30 days of hire.
  8. Bend, reach overhead, maneuver, and lift items to 40 lbs., stand for long periods, operate cleaning equipment, and perform repetitive motions using arms, wrists, hands, and fingers.
  9. Flexible schedule and able to work various days and shifts, including weekends and holidays.
  10. Requires a criminal history background check.
  11. Must be at least 16 years of age.
